推荐开源项目:Hologram.nvim - 带你探索Neovim的全新时代
项目简介
是一个为Neovim打造的现代化主题包,它将你的代码编辑器转化为一款视觉享受与高效开发并存的工具。该项目基于Nvim-Tree.lua和Telescope.nvim,旨在提升Neovim的用户体验,使界面更美观且易于操作。
技术分析
Hologram.nvim 的核心特点在于其对Neovim Lua API的充分利用,这使得它可以无缝地与其他Lua插件协同工作。项目依赖于以下关键技术:
-
Neovim's Lua Support:Neovim 提供了原生的 Lua 支持,让开发者可以编写高性能、低延迟的插件。Hologram 利用这一特性创建出流畅的界面体验。
-
Nvim-Tree.lua:这是一个强大的文件管理器,用于在Neovim中浏览和操作文件系统。Hologram与其整合,提供清晰的文件视图。
-
Telescope.nvim:Telescope是一个搜索扩展,支持多种数据源的快速查找和选择。Hologram通过Telescope增强了导航和搜索功能。
-
Colorscheme & Theming:Hologram引入了一套时尚的颜色方案,确保代码既可读又悦目。同时,它也支持自定义主题,满足个性化需求。
应用场景
Hologram.nvim 可以广泛应用于各类开发环境,无论你是Web开发者、后端工程师还是仅仅是一个文本编辑器爱好者。其主要功能包括:
- 代码编辑:通过美观的语法高亮,提高代码可读性。
- 文件管理:借助Nvim-Tree,轻松打开、移动或删除文件。
- 高效导航:利用Telescope快速查找文件、符号、历史记录等。
- 个性化配置:根据个人喜好调整颜色方案和布局。
特点与优势
- 极致性能:基于Lua的实现保证了优秀的运行效率。
- 美观界面:现代设计风格,提供舒适的编码环境。
- 高度可定制:允许用户自定义颜色、图标和布局。
- 良好社区支持:作为开源项目,Hologram有活跃的开发团队和社区,持续更新优化。
结语
如果你是Neovim的使用者,或者正在寻找一个既实用又美观的代码编辑器增强工具,Hologram.nvim绝对值得一试。它的出色性能、丰富的功能和高度的灵活性,会让你的工作变得更加愉快。现在就加入到Hologram的世界,体验全新的Neovim之旅吧!
项目链接:.nvim?utm_source=artical_gitcode
希望这篇推荐能帮助你发现这个宝藏项目,祝你在编程的路上更加得心应手!